Vasco shock Mohun Bagan

Vasco caused a huge upset in the Federation Cup football tournament, beating Kolkata giants Mohun Bagan 6-5 on penalties, after both sides failed to break the deadlock in regulation and extra-time, at the Nehru stadium in Margao, Goa, on Saturday.

Vasco now play Salgaocar, another Goa side, in the quarter finals. Salgaocar got the better of Punjab Police 3-1 in another first round match earlier in the evening.

Mohun Bagan paid the price for their profligacy and have themselves to blame for the defeat. They controlled play and had vast spells of dominance over their rather inexperienced opponents but their strikers lacked the finish. Added to their woes the Vasco defence put up a commendable show.

After the teams were level 4-4 in the tie-breaker, Anthony Fernandes and Rovan Pereira found the net for Vasco in sudden-death while Tomba Singh failed to score, his shot hitting the crossbar, after Mehtab Hossein converted.

In the tie-breaker, Desmond Fernandes, Caitan Costa, Anthony Pereira and Milagrio Medeira scored for Vasco while Cedric Pexeito's kick was saved by Bagan 'keeper Subrata Paul.

For Bagan, Gleyyao Rodrique, Noel Wilson, Eduardo Lacerda and Dharamjit Singh found the net in the tie-breaker while Mehrajuddin Wadoo shot out.

Vasco's Anthony Pereira was named the man of the match.
